Swingers who hold sex parties in a suburban Dallas home say in a lawsuit that their lifestyle is being unconstitutionally targeted by a city ordinance.
Jim Trulock, whose home transforms into "The Cherry Pit" on weekends, sued the City of Duncanville on Wednesday. City officials last month passed an ordinance banning sex clubs, calling it a response to neighbor complaints about the traffic and noise The Cherry Pit attracts each weekend.
Upward of 100 people attend the parties, which feature themes like "Naked Twister" nights.
The lawsuit accuses the city of having no "constitutionally acceptable" grounds to enact the ordinance.
City spokeswoman Tonya Lewis had no immediate comment.
